The read// why locals go

Maha’s Cafe brings scratch-made Egyptian brunch to Queen Street East in Toronto, cooking the sweet-spiced dishes of Cairo the way a family kitchen would. Head chef Maha Barsoom opened the Leslieville room in 2014 alongside Monika Wahba and barista Mark Wahba, and it is still the family’s only location. The kitchen’s own promise is food made from scratch, exactly as you would taste it in Egypt: the Cairo Classic with Egyptian falafel, the Pharaoh’s po’ boy, and a red lentil soup sold by the one-litre mason jar. The Michelin Guide has singled out the Cairo Classic and Toronto Life called it a contender for the city’s best — recognition for what remains a small, independent neighbourhood favourite.
